HEALTHY CLUBS

 Healthy Clubs Committee is busy organising some events for the off-season.

  • Ireland Lights Up Challenge will commence on 8th January and run until 12th February. The goal of this challenge is collectively hit 4,000km and be included in a draw to win a share of €30,000 prize fund. The following steps to join – 1) Download MYLIFE app, 2) Join the Challenge – go to Social > Challenges> My Life Every Step Counts Challenge > your province > find Laune Rangers to join. The club will also be organise some walks as the club has registered with Get Ireland Walking.

SCÓR

Scór na nÓg & Scór na bPáistí will be returning.

There are eight disciplines in Scór that cover all aspects of Irish culture: Figure/Céilí Dancing, Solo Singing, Ballad Group, Recitation/Scéalaíocht, Nuachleas/Novelty Act, Instrumental Music, Set Dancing and Table Quiz.

The competion is open to all young people under 17.

If you are not a member for GAA purposes there is social membership also available.
